The Evolution of Car Keys
Typically, car keys were easy mechanical gadgets. Nevertheless, with improvements in automobile innovation, electronic keys emerged. Electronic car keys, frequently referred to as clever keys or key fobs, use radio frequency recognition (RFID) or Bluetooth innovation to communicate with the vehicle. This modern key system provides numerous advantages, including:
Enhanced Security: Electronic keys are harder to replicate than conventional keys.Convenience: Many new designs permit keyless entry and ignition systems.Remote Functions: Some electronic keys can control other functions, such as the trunk release or vehicle alarm.Types of Electronic Car KeysKey Fobs: Compact remote controls that unlock doors and start the engine when within distance.Smart Keys: Allow keyless entry and ignition, allowing motorists to begin the car with the key still in their pocket or bag.Transponder Keys: Contain a small chip programmed to the vehicle, enhancing security versus theft.The Replacement Process
When an electronic car key is lost or harmed, replacing it can appear daunting. Here's a detailed procedure to comprehend how to go about it:
1. Identify the Type of KeyKey Fob: Determine if the key fob needs programming.Smart Key: Check if the replacement needs the vehicle to be present for programs.2. Inspect for Spare Keys
Always confirm if a spare key is accessible. This can conserve both money and time.
3. Contact a Professional
Engaging a locksmith or dealership is critical. Choose the very best choice for your scenario:
Dealership: More pricey however may offer the very best quality and programs.Locksmith professional: Often more economical and can offer mobile services.4. Prepare Necessary Documentation
Before replacements, guarantee you have needed files, such as:
Vehicle registrationRecognitionEvidence of ownership5. Setting the New Key
The new key must be configured to communicate with the vehicle's security system. This procedure can be performed by a dealer or locksmith.
6. Evaluate the New Key
Constantly evaluate the brand-new key after replacement to guarantee that it operates correctly with all features, including locking/unlocking doors and starting the engine.
Estimated Costs
The expense of replacing electronic car keys can vary substantially based upon the kind of key and provider. Below is a table breaking down some average expenses:
Key TypeAverage Replacement Cost (₤)Programming Cost (₤)Total Estimated Cost (₤)Basic Key Fob100 - 20050 - 100150 - 300Smart Key200 - 40075 - 150275 - 550Transponder Key50 - 15030 - 10080 - 250Expert Lock Smith Service50 - 150 (mobile)N/A50 - 150Car dealership Service200 - 600Included200 - 600Challenges in Key Replacement
Replacing electronic car keys often features its difficulties, consisting of:
High Costs: The cost of key replacement and programs can be considerable, depending on the vehicle design.Restricted Availability: Some keys, specifically for high-end lorries, may have restricted availability and longer waiting times.Technological Complexity: The shows of clever keys typically requires innovative devices and know-how.Frequently Asked QuestionsQ1: Can I replace my electronic key myself?
A1: While some standard key fobs can be set by the owner, a lot of electronic and smart keys require specialized devices and are best managed by car dealerships or expert locksmiths.
Q2: Is it possible to replicate an electronic key?
A2: Yes, electronic keys can be duplicated, however the procedure is more complex than conventional keys. It often needs programs to ensure it works with the vehicle's security system.
Q3: What if I do not have a spare key?
A3: If no spare key is readily available, you'll need to get in touch with a car dealership or an expert locksmith professional to replace and program a new key, which generally involves more steps and costs.
Q4: How long does the replacement process usually take?
A4: The replacement process might take from a couple of minutes to numerous hours, depending upon the key type and whether programs is needed. Dealers might take longer due to their protocols.
Q5: Are electronic keys more safe than standard keys?
A5: Yes, electronic keys feature sophisticated security technologies that make them more resistant to theft and duplication than standard keys.
